易语言是一种基于Windows操作系统的编程语言,它的设计目标是简易、高效、易学易用。在实际应用中,我们常常需要获取网络文件的大小以及文件的路径,以便进行其他操作。本文将介绍如何使用易语言来实现这两个功能。

易语言取网络文件大小,易语言获取文件路径

让我们来看看如何使用易语言获取网络文件的大小。为了实现这一功能,我们需要使用到一些网络相关的函数和方法。易语言提供了丰富的网络编程接口,例如通过HTTP协议下载文件、获取文件的大小等。

在易语言中,我们可以使用Wininet库中的一些函数来获取网络文件的大小。其中最常用的函数是InternetOpen、InternetOpenURL和HttpQueryInfo。我们需要调用InternetOpen函数创建一个用于与网络资源进行通信的句柄。使用InternetOpenURL函数打开一个URL地址,并返回一个用于与该URL资源进行通信的句柄。使用HttpQueryInfo函数获取文件的大小信息。

我们来讨论如何使用易语言获取文件的路径。在易语言中,我们可以使用一些系统函数和方法来获取文件的路径。我们可以使用GetModuleFileName函数来获取当前执行的可执行文件的路径。该函数接受一个参数,用于指定缓冲区的大小,并将可执行文件的路径写入该缓冲区。我们还可以使用GetFullPathName函数来获取指定文件的完整路径。该函数接受两个参数,分别是文件名和用于存储路径的缓冲区。

通过上述的介绍,我们可以看出,易语言提供了丰富的功能来获取网络文件的大小和文件的路径。通过学习和使用这些函数和方法,我们可以轻松地实现这两个功能,并在实际应用中发挥它们的作用。

本文主要介绍了使用易语言获取网络文件大小和文件路径的方法。通过调用相关的函数和方法,我们可以获取到网络文件的大小和文件的路径,并在实际应用中使用它们。易语言作为一种简易、高效、易学易用的编程语言,在网络编程方面有着很大的优势。通过学习和使用这些功能,我们可以更好地应用易语言来进行网络开发。

易语言获取文件路径

易语言是一种基于Windows操作系统的编程语言,它简单易学,适合初学者入门。在编写程序时,经常需要获取文件的路径,以便对文件进行读取、写入或其他操作。本文将介绍易语言获取文件路径的方法,并提供一些比较和对比的手法来吸引读者的注意力和兴趣。

我们来看一下使用易语言获取当前执行文件路径的方法。在易语言中,可以使用API函数GetModuleFileName来获取当前执行文件的路径。这个函数的原型如下所示:

GetModuleFileName(hModule, lpFileName, nSize)

hModule参数为NULL,表示获取当前应用程序的路径;lpFileName参数为一个字符串变量,用来存放文件路径;nSize参数表示lpFileName可以存放的最大字符个数。

我们还可以使用函数GetCommandLine来获取当前执行文件的路径。这个函数的原型如下所示:

GetCommandLine(lpCmdLine, cbCmdLine)

lpCmdLine参数为一个字符串变量,用来存放命令行参数;cbCmdLine参数表示lpCmdLine可以存放的最大字符个数。

相比之下,使用GetModuleFileName函数获取文件路径更为直观和简单,因此在实际编程中更常用。

除了获取当前执行文件的路径,有时我们还需要获取其他文件的路径。在易语言中,可以使用函数OpenFileDialog来打开一个文件对话框,选择文件后获取文件路径。这个函数的原型如下所示:

OpenFileDialog(hWnd, sFilter, sInitDir, sTitle, sDefExt)

hWnd参数为窗口的句柄;sFilter参数表示文件的过滤器,用来限定可以选择的文件类型;sInitDir参数表示文件对话框的初始目录;sTitle参数表示文件对话框的标题;sDefExt参数表示默认的文件扩展名。

使用OpenFileDialog函数可以方便地获取用户选择的文件路径,适用于需要用户主动选择文件的情况。

本文介绍了在易语言中获取文件路径的方法。通过使用GetModuleFileName函数可以获取当前执行文件的路径,而使用OpenFileDialog函数则可以打开文件对话框选择文件并获取文件路径。无论是获取当前执行文件的路径还是其他文件的路径,易语言都提供了简单有效的方法来实现。希望本文对易语言初学者有所帮助,能够更好地使用易语言进行文件操作。

易语言取文件路径

易语言是一种面向对象的高级计算机编程语言,以其简单易学、上手快等优势,被广泛应用于软件开发领域。在使用易语言编写程序时,经常需要获取文件的路径信息,以便进行文件的读取、写入等操作。本文将介绍易语言中如何取得文件路径,并探讨几种常见的方法。

获取文件路径是程序开发中的一项基础工作,对于易语言编程而言也不例外。掌握取得文件路径的方法对程序的正确运行和文件的有效利用至关重要。本文将为大家介绍易语言中的文件路径获取相关知识,帮助读者更好地理解和应用。

一、使用系统变量获取文件路径

在易语言中,可以使用系统变量来获取文件路径。系统变量_自身路径用于返回当前程序所在目录的路径,可以使用该变量获取当前程序所在目录的完整路径。同样地,系统变量_系统路径可以用于获取操作系统的安装路径。这些系统变量方便了我们快速获取文件路径,提高了编程效率。

二、使用API函数获取文件路径

除了系统变量,我们还可以通过调用API函数来获取文件路径。Windows操作系统提供了一系列API函数,其中包含了获取文件路径的相关函数。GetModuleFileName函数可以获取一个可执行文件的路径和文件名,通过对该路径进行处理,即可得到文件路径。GetTempPath函数可以获取系统临时文件夹的路径,这在一些需要创建临时文件的程序中常常被使用。

三、使用文件对话框获取文件路径

文件对话框是一种常见的与用户交互的界面控件,易语言中也提供了相关的函数和接口来实现文件对话框的功能。用户可以通过文件对话框选择一个或多个文件,然后获取这些文件的路径。通过使用易语言提供的文件对话框函数,我们可以在程序中方便地引入文件选择功能。

通过以上三种方法,我们可以轻松获取文件路径,为程序的编写和文件的处理提供了便利。在实际编程中,我们可以根据不同的需求选择不同的方法,灵活应用于各种场景。

文件路径获取是易语言编程中的一项基础工作,掌握相关知识对于程序的正确运行和文件的有效利用至关重要。本文介绍了易语言中几种常见的获取文件路径的方法,包括使用系统变量、API函数和文件对话框等。通过这些方法,我们可以轻松获取文件路径,提高程序的编写效率和文件的处理效果。希望本文能够对读者在易语言编程中的文件路径获取工作提供参考和帮助。